How they compare
Russia currently reports 24.1% against 23.9% in Niue, a difference of 0.2%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Niue ahead.
Niue ranks 120th and Russia ranks 117th of 209 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Niue averaged higher in 2 and Russia in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Niue | Russia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 21.4% | 20.2% | 1.2% | Niue |
| 2010s | 21.4% | 20.5% | 0.8% | Niue |
| 2020s | 23.1% | 23.1% | 0.0% | Russia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
